Today i did get my christmas present : 1940 Buick owners manual ..I looked how they changed a flat tire in 1940 .Several tools to do that .Grab the wheel rim , lift it and then another tool to support the brake drum and then you could remove the wheel and then the other way around .I don't have any of the tools in my car and i wonder if anybody ever used those tools .Very dangerous if you ask me .I think the tool to support the brake drum is the same that holds the spare wheel in the trunk .I'm missing that also .I would like to buy that support if I can .

Can't keep the engine gasses from running me out of the cab
daniel boeve replied to Skidplate's topic in Buick - Pre War
Its all very simple when you ask me .There must be a little overpressure in the cabin , so when you drive you don't suck in the wrong air from the engine but from someplace else .That vent or how do you call that opens on top in front of the windscreen open it , those little windows turn them open so fresh air is forced in instead of out of the cabin . -
